The phrases “fallen from grace” and “alienated” are truly disappointing to hear. I understand why other players might feel this way, but at some point you would think that petty politics and 3rd-grade level sensibilites would not cloud players from having rational judgement.

Do you have a better QB than Griffin?

No. No, you do not. So shut up then, follow his leadership, and play ball, and win games.

I, amongst other Redskins fans, are truly sick of this crap.

Many of the same players last season, who were so excited to see how Kirk Cousins would do as starter. The same kind of “off-the-record” comments and undercurrent of “thank god that DIVA isn’t playing QB for us anymore!” reports can be easily dug up on the web from last fall.

And we saw how that worked out.

I don’t really care if the decision to start RG3 this week was a GM/Owner level mandate. If it was, it only means to me that we’ve got a dummy for coach, who can’t see the long term direction of the team, and is grasping at getting lucky with Colt McCoy for another week.

Let me reiterate: we are in the RG3 Business. We need to BE in that business, without reservation, until at LEAST the end of the 2015 season. That will make 4 full years. We can start to chart an alternate course at that time.

For now, start him, help him, coach him, believe in him, and everyone else on this team shut the fuck up and stop talking to ESPN reporters off the record.
